Support Activities

Icon

Firm Infrastructure

Republic Airways Holdings, Inc.'s firm infrastructure centers on safety oversight, FAA compliance, finance, and network planning, because its fixed-fee model must stay tightly synced with American Eagle, Delta Connection, and United Express schedules. In 2025, this structure supports reliable block-hour execution, cost control, and on-time coordination across 3 major partners. Strong governance is a direct operating need, not a back-office extra.

Icon

Human Resource Management

Republic Airways Holdings, Inc. runs a people-heavy model, so pilots, flight attendants, mechanics, and dispatchers drive both cost and reliability. Training and recurrent checks matter because Embraer 170/175 flying depends on qualified crews at all times.

In fiscal 2025, labor, training, and retention stayed central to safety and on-time performance, since any crew gap can ripple through the schedule. Strong HR control is a direct operating lever, not a back-office task.

Technology Development

In 2025, Republic Airways Holdings, Inc. relied on dispatch, maintenance-tracking, and crew-scheduling systems to keep aircraft, crews, and flight plans aligned across its fixed-fee capacity purchase agreements. That matters because even small data gaps can raise aircraft downtime and delay costs. Better operational data helps Republic Airways Holdings, Inc. protect on-time reliability and keep its low-margin network running with fewer disruptions.

Icon

Procurement

In 2025, Republic Airways Holdings, Inc. procurement covers spare parts, maintenance inputs, airport services, IT systems, and other operating supplies that keep the Embraer 170/175 fleet flying on schedule. Strong sourcing matters because one aircraft-on-ground event can quickly raise repair spend and disrupt a fixed-fee model that rewards reliability, not higher unit costs. Tight vendor control, spare-parts planning, and service contracts help Republic Airways Holdings, Inc. protect margins while meeting airline partner uptime demands.

Primary Activities

Icon

Inbound Logistics

In fiscal 2025, Republic Airways Holdings, Inc. inbound logistics centered on time-critical spare parts, maintenance materials, and cabin provisioning moving 24/7 to keep each flight cycle ready. The biggest value is speed: parts, tools, and crew positioning have to line up so aircraft can enter service on time and avoid costly ground delays. This upstream flow supports high aircraft utilization, which matters in a business where even small downtime can disrupt hundreds of daily departures.

Icon

Operations

Republic Airways Holdings, Inc. runs scheduled passenger flights on Embraer 170/175 aircraft for American Eagle, Delta Connection, and United Express under fixed-fee contracts, so safe dispatch and completion rate directly drive revenue. In 2025, that makes aircraft utilization a key lever, because every extra block hour spreads fixed costs across more flights. The operating focus is simple: keep planes flying, keep delays low, and keep completion high.

Outbound Logistics

Republic Airways Holdings, Inc. runs outbound logistics through partner schedules, airport systems, and tight gate turns across more than 200 Embraer E170/E175 jets in fiscal 2025. Passenger, bag, and aircraft flow must stay synced because American Airlines, Delta Air Lines, and United Airlines use Republic Airways Holdings, Inc. to feed hub traffic. One late turn can ripple through several banked departures, so on-time handoffs and baggage control are core value drivers.

Icon

Marketing and Sales

Republic Airways Holdings, Inc. sells lift to airline partners through contract renewals, not consumer ads. Its marketing and sales work is built on on-time performance, low unit costs, and clear monthly reporting that helps partners track service and capacity. In a 2025 budget era of tighter airline margins, keeping block-hour reliability high is what protects renewal bids and supports fleet use.

Icon

Service

Republic Airways Holdings, Inc. supports service by handling irregular operations fast, keeping passengers informed on delays, and running safety-first recovery steps. In 2025, that matters because regional flying can face weather, ATC, and crew swaps that ripple through partner networks; strong disruption handling helps protect repeat contract value. The service layer also reduces missed connections and protects on-time performance, which matters for American Airlines, Delta Air Lines, and United Airlines partners.

Republic Airways Holdings, Inc. sells scheduled regional flying capacity, not direct retail tickets. Its model is built on fixed-fee capacity purchase agreements with 3 major partners: American Eagle, Delta Connection, and United Express. The airline flies Embraer 170/175 aircraft, so revenue depends on safety, completion, and reliability rather than fare setting.
